Maharashtra · Assembly Constituency 193 · 1962
Bhandara
Winner — 1962
DADA DA JIBAJI DHOTE
INC· INC
INC 42.2%REP 26.8%2 others 31.0%
Votes
17,855
42.1% share
Winning margin
6,491
15.3% of votes
Total candidates
4
Turnout
62.5%
of 67,828
Bhandara is a safe seat — DADA DA JIBAJI DHOTE won by 15.3%.
Seat history
All Candidates
4 total| # |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| DADA DA JIBAJI DHOTE | INC | 17,855 | 42.1% |
| 2 | SADANAND MANGALRAM RAMTEKE | REP | 11,364 | 26.8% |
| 3 | SAKHARAM BALAJI PARSHODKAR | IND | 9,780 | 23.1% |
| 4 | BHASKARRAO BALIRAM NINAWE | 3,358 | 7.9% |
DL — deposit lost: the candidate polled under one-sixth of valid votes and forfeits their election deposit under RPA 1951 s.158.
